The Shirley Fiterman Art Center (SFAC) at Borough of Manhattan Community College (BMCC) of the City University of New York (CUNY) is dedicated to organizing exhibitions of contemporary art and cultural programming through which it seeks to promote and enrich the educational mission of BMCC and serve as a resource for the BMCC and Lower Manhattan communities. These exhibitions are intended to provide diverse gallery programs that allow a place to engage with contemporary art and investigate a deeper understanding of its role in society at a venue that is free of charge and open to the public.

We believe in the fundamental role of education and advocacy through art and in the preservation of the artistic and historic legacies of Tribeca and Lower Manhattan. We seek to galvanize the cultural landscape of the community, compliment the academic and visual arts programs of the college, and foster wider appreciation of contemporary art and cultural understanding.
